Model 9LZD-9.0 Trailed Finger wheel Rake of Technical Specifications

Project / ItemSpecifications & Units
Model Designation9LZD-9.0 Trailed Finger-wheel Rake
Structural FormFinger-wheel Type (17 Units)
Hitch TypeTrailed / Towed (Drawbar)
Matching Power (Kw/HP)55 - 75 Kw / 75 - 102 HP
Working Dimensions (L×W×H)16.8 m × 3.9 m × 1.6 m
Machine Curb Weight1240 kg
Total Working Width9.0 Meters
Optimal Working Speed8 - 10 km/h
Safe Transport SpeedMax 12 km/h
Number of Wheels / Tines17 Wheels / 1020 Tines (60 Tines per Wheel)
Required Personnel1 (Tractor Operator)
Adjustable Windrow Width0.8 - 1.2 Meters
Raking Accuracy (Loss Rate)≤ 2.0%
Productivity (Area per Hour)7.2 - 9.0 hm²/h

Solving Key Challenges in Modern Forage Harvesting

Efficient forage management is the difference between high-quality silage and wasted nutrients. As a leading Agricultural finger wheel rake manufacturer, we have optimized the 9LZD-9.0 to address specific field difficulties:

1. Maximizing Operational Efficiency

In narrow harvest windows, speed is essential. With a 9-meter swath, this Hay Rake allows you to cover nearly 9 hectares per hour. This reduces the number of tractor passes required to clear a field by over 35%, leading to significant savings in diesel fuel and operator hours.

2. Minimizing Harvest Loss & Contamination

A major pain point for farmers is "missed grass" or "soil mixing." Our 17-wheel design ensures that wheels overlap perfectly. The ≤2% loss rate is achieved through independent wheel suspension, which allows each finger wheel to follow the ground's micro-contour without digging into the dirt, ensuring a clean, high-protein yield.

3. Optimized Drying & Aeration

Windrows that are too tight will trap moisture and lead to mold. The finger-wheel mechanism gently lifts and rolls the crop rather than dragging it. This creates "lofty" windrows with maximum air volume, accelerating the natural sun-drying process and preparing the crop for the baler in record time.

4. Simplified Hydraulic Maneuverability

Maneuvering a 16.8-meter machine used to be a challenge. The 9LZD-9.0 finger wheel hay rake features a integrated hydraulic lift system. The operator can raise the finger wheels for headland turns or fold the entire unit into a compact 3.9m transport width without ever leaving the tractor seat.

Professional Maintenance & Longevity Guide

To ensure your finger wheel hay rake operates at peak performance for decades, follow these factory-recommended maintenance protocols:

Daily Pre-Operation Check:

Inspect all 1020 tines for bends or breaks. Replace any missing finger wheel rake parts immediately to maintain raking balance and prevent uneven windrows.

Lubrication Schedule:

Grease all main pivot points and wheel hub bearings every 40 working hours. Use high-quality lithium-based grease to protect against dust and moisture ingress.

Hydraulic System Integrity:

Check hydraulic hoses for abrasions or leaks. Ensure fluid levels in the tractor are adequate to prevent cavitation in the rake's lift cylinders.

Off-Season Storage:

Clean the machine thoroughly to remove corrosive crop sap. Coat the spring steel tines with a thin layer of protective oil and store the unit in a dry, covered area to prevent oxidation.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: What makes your finger wheels different from standard models?
Our wheels are equipped with 60 high-density tines made of heat-treated spring steel. This density ensures that even fine-stemmed crops are raked cleanly, reducing waste by up to 15% compared to 40-tine wheels.

Q2: Is the windrow width adjustable on the 9LZD-9.0 finger wheel hay rake?
Yes. By adjusting the angle of the rear raking arms via the hydraulic control, you can vary the windrow width between 0.8m and 1.2m to perfectly match the pickup width of your baler.

Q3: Can I replace individual finger wheel rake parts easily?
Absolutely. The machine is designed with a modular architecture. Individual tines are bolted, not welded, and entire wheel hubs can be swapped out in under 10 minutes using standard tools.

Q4: What is the optimal tractor horsepower for this rake?
While the machine can technically run on 75 HP, we recommend 90-100 HP for hilly terrain or exceptionally heavy, damp crops to maintain a steady 10km/h working speed.

Q5: How does the trailed design improve stability?
The 16.8m frame is supported by heavy-duty agricultural tires that provide a wide stance. This prevents the "bouncing" effect common in three-point linkage rakes, ensuring consistent tine depth across the entire 9m width.
